    Straub Brewery is a small family brewery still making beer the way it was intended by Peter Straub…read moreover a century ago ("honestly fresh, fiercely independent"). There's history here and even if you're not a fan of the beer you have to respect the tradition. The brewery offers tours (I was there on a Tuesday for the 10:30am tour). The tour of the brewery provided a history of their process and some fun stories (brownies vs greenies!) and lasts about an hour. Be warned, you walk up and down quite a few flights of stairs for the tour. There is a small gift shop on site where you can buy the usual brewery souvenirs along with bottles of beer. Straub continues their tradition of the classic lager line (no added sugar, salt or preservatives) and they've also expanded to a signature line of beers for the ever changing beer market. It's good to see that even with age Straub understands the need for additional new products. The best part of Straub Brewery though is the Eternal Tap. Anyone from anywhere can come in to the brewery and enjoy a complimentary beer from the tap (2 beer limit). The tap does not appear to be well supervised so they expect you to be honest in exchange for their generous hospitality. They just ask that you wash your glass. Even if you don't have time for the tour (which lasts 60-90 minutes depending on your tour guide, the size of your group and any questions asked) make time to stop by for a cold one from the source. Just so you can say you did.
